你查询的IP:[119.144.29.123]  地理位置:中国–广东–东莞

最新查询221.198.90.19 219.244.97.173 117.121.54.123 202.38.194.161 211.160.27.147 119.40.129.173 119.40.148.246 118.126.100.60 118.120.61.155 119.144.29.123 192.83.122.93 125.208.9.59 202.90.252.1 202.131.16.48 116.76.70.129 203.171.224.9 124.172.237.86 211.64.219.207 202.38.168.56 116.242.28.247 203.142.219.184 120.72.128.155 123.144.18.199 219.242.73.114 203.134.240.67 58.87.64.7 123.196.244.232 202.96.125.27 202.85.208.47 220.160.96.125 124.40.128.253